


Rows A-L of the Orchestra and Row A of the Mezzanine offer the best views of the stage with minimal to no sightline restrictions.
Both sections have wheelchair-accessibility and are ADA-compliant. There is designated seating for patrons with mobility needs, step-free access for the Orchestra, elevator and escalator access for the Mezzanine, and all restrooms at this venue have wheelchair accessibility. Additionally, you can contact the venue in advance to book your accessible seats and enquire about any specific requirements you may have.
Seats toward the ends of the rows and in the rear of each section offer more affordability for patrons on a budget. Orchestra Rows O-Q are generally cheaper than the front-row premium seats. Orchestra Rows M-N and Mezzanine Row A tend to be priced slightly higher, but are still considerably cheaper than premium seats.
